Output 2e1b84ebe7377620650ed542382090c76a4dc1df9b73bd41b1d01226d5bc3910:0

value
2903955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b55a8a5b79c0c28c8f1c203e168dbc183fe5b6dc OP_EQUAL
address
3JDvh8HRhBhZv4mh4cjus99Bifu8RXoq1Z
transaction
2e1b84ebe7377620650ed542382090c76a4dc1df9b73bd41b1d01226d5bc3910
spent
true